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89660693700 353269492 495068260 48973580
758700 6893184
758700 6893184
55966883 07397985480 49201317
All about undefined
Interested in learning more?
758700 6893184
55966883 07397985480 49201317
See more
695790 412748178 96578814208
33 084728634 332 78
See more
653917 108504386 674736744
3595934968 671036620 58
See more